New York
New York legalized compensated gestational surrogacy in 2020 with the Child-Parent Security Act (CPSA), making it one of the newer surrogate-friendly jurisdictions on the East Coast.
Surrogacy Laws
Child-Parent Security Act (2020) explicitly permits compensated gestational surrogacy. Pre-birth parentage orders available.
Surrogate-Friendly Provisions
Compensated surrogacy permitted • Pre-birth orders • Same-sex and single IP recognition • Strong surrogate-rights protections (legal counsel, escrow, health insurance)
